Eggs per bird in Mali
Mali: Eggs per bird was 2.51 kilograms per animal in 2024. ▲ Rising
Eggs per bird in Mali, 1961–2024
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ations (2025) – with major processing by Our World in Data. Measured in kilograms per animal.
Analysis
In 2024, eggs per bird in Mali stood at 2.51 kilograms per animal.
The figure is down 20.8% on the previous year and down 22.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, eggs per bird in Mali peaked at 3.26 kilograms per animal in 2022 and was at its lowest, 1.8 kilograms per animal, in 1961.
That places Mali 190th out of 197 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 64 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 1.8 kilograms per animal | 1.8 kilograms per animal | 1.8 kilograms per animal | 9 |
| 1970s | 1.8 kilograms per animal | 1.8 kilograms per animal | 1.8 kilograms per animal | 10 |
| 1980s | 1.8 kilograms per animal | 1.8 kilograms per animal | 1.8 kilograms per animal | 10 |
| 1990s | 2.98 kilograms per animal | 1.8 kilograms per animal | 3.12 kilograms per animal | 10 |
| 2000s | 3.13 kilograms per animal | 3.09 kilograms per animal | 3.19 kilograms per animal | 10 |
| 2010s | 3.1 kilograms per animal | 2.91 kilograms per animal | 3.26 kilograms per animal | 10 |
| 2020s | 2.95 kilograms per animal | 2.51 kilograms per animal | 3.26 kilograms per animal | 5 |
